Why bearing remanufacturing service?
Wear, corrosion, indentations, microcracks… Certain application conditions, like contamination or sporadic metal–to–metal contact in the rolling contact zone, can cause all sorts of damage to your bearings. As a result, the service life of a bearing is often shorter than the calculated rating life. The alternative is to apply a controlled remanufacturing process before any
major damage or bearing failure occurs. This can substantially prolong the service life of the bearing in question, reducing costs and lead times. And since it requires less energy than manufacturing a new bearing, it is better for the environment as well.
The typical candidates for industrial bearing remanufacturing are:
• large size bearings
• CARB and spherical roller bearings used in continuous caster lines
• backing bearings
• slewing bearings

Depending on the amount of remanufacturing required, up to 90% less energy is needed to remanufacture a bearing instead of manufacturing a new one. Furthermore, cost-benefit analysis shows that significant cost savings can be achieved by remanufacturing bearings – depending on bearing size, complexity, bearing condition and price. In addition to reducing the energy use, Quantbearing’s remanufacturing services help protect the environment by responsible cleaning of bearings and handling of waste.
